What is: Z-Transformation

What is Z-Transformation?

Z-Transformation, also known as Z-score normalization or standardization, is a statistical technique used to transform data points into a standard scale with a mean of zero and a standard deviation of one. This process is essential in various fields, including statistics, data analysis, and data science, as it allows for the comparison of scores from different distributions. By converting raw scores into Z-scores, analysts can better understand how individual data points relate to the overall dataset, facilitating more accurate interpretations and analyses.

Advertisement
Advertisement

Ad Title

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

Understanding the Z-Score

The Z-score is a numerical measurement that describes a value’s relationship to the mean of a group of values. It is calculated by taking the difference between the value and the mean, then dividing that difference by the standard deviation of the dataset. Mathematically, the Z-score can be expressed as:

[ Z = frac{(X – mu)}{sigma} ]

where ( X ) is the value, ( mu ) is the mean of the dataset, and ( sigma ) is the standard deviation. A Z-score indicates how many standard deviations a data point is from the mean, providing insight into its relative position within the distribution.

Applications of Z-Transformation

Z-Transformation is widely used in various applications, including hypothesis testing, anomaly detection, and data preprocessing for machine learning algorithms. In hypothesis testing, Z-scores help determine the likelihood of observing a particular data point under a normal distribution. In anomaly detection, Z-scores can identify outliers by flagging data points that fall significantly outside the expected range. Additionally, in machine learning, Z-Transformation is often employed to standardize features, ensuring that models are not biased towards variables with larger scales.

Advertisement
Advertisement

Ad Title

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

Benefits of Z-Transformation

One of the primary benefits of Z-Transformation is its ability to normalize data, which enhances the performance of statistical analyses and machine learning models. By standardizing the data, analysts can ensure that each feature contributes equally to the analysis, preventing any single variable from disproportionately influencing the results. Furthermore, Z-Transformation can improve the convergence speed of optimization algorithms, making it a valuable preprocessing step in data science workflows.

Limitations of Z-Transformation

Despite its advantages, Z-Transformation has some limitations. It assumes that the data follows a normal distribution, which may not always be the case. When applied to non-normally distributed data, the resulting Z-scores may not accurately represent the underlying relationships within the data. Additionally, Z-Transformation is sensitive to outliers, as extreme values can skew the mean and standard deviation, leading to misleading Z-scores. Therefore, it is crucial to assess the data’s distribution and consider alternative normalization techniques when necessary.

How to Perform Z-Transformation

Performing Z-Transformation involves a straightforward process. First, calculate the mean and standard deviation of the dataset. Next, for each data point, subtract the mean and divide the result by the standard deviation. This calculation can be easily implemented using programming languages such as Python or R, where libraries like NumPy and pandas provide built-in functions for efficient computation. By automating this process, data analysts can quickly standardize large datasets, facilitating further analysis and modeling.

Interpreting Z-Scores

Interpreting Z-scores is crucial for understanding the significance of individual data points within a dataset. A Z-score of 0 indicates that the data point is exactly at the mean, while positive Z-scores signify values above the mean and negative Z-scores indicate values below the mean. Generally, Z-scores greater than 2 or less than -2 are considered unusual and may warrant further investigation. Analysts often use Z-scores to compare data points across different datasets, enabling more comprehensive insights into the relationships between variables.

Z-Transformation in Machine Learning

In machine learning, Z-Transformation is a common preprocessing step that helps improve model performance. Many algorithms, particularly those based on distance metrics like k-nearest neighbors and support vector machines, are sensitive to the scale of the input features. By standardizing the features using Z-Transformation, data scientists can ensure that all features contribute equally to the model’s learning process. This standardization can lead to faster convergence during training and improved accuracy in predictions.

Conclusion on Z-Transformation

Z-Transformation is a fundamental technique in statistics and data analysis that enables the standardization of data points for better comparison and interpretation. By converting raw scores into Z-scores, analysts can gain valuable insights into the relationships within datasets, enhancing the accuracy of statistical analyses and machine learning models. Understanding the principles and applications of Z-Transformation is essential for data professionals aiming to leverage data effectively in their analyses and decision-making processes.

Advertisement
Advertisement

Ad Title

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.